异形坯连铸过程流场与温度场耦合三维数值模拟
3-D COUPLED NUMERICAL SIMULATION FOR FLOWING DISTRIBUTION AND TEMPERATURE DISTRIBUTION IN BEAM BLANK CONTINUOUS CASTING PROCESS
【摘要】 建立了异形坯内流体流动与凝固传热的三维耦合模型,充分考虑了对流换热对凝固过程的影响,分析了铸坯与钢液之间的相互作用,并对不同工艺条件下的温度场进行了比较.运用此模型可预报铸坯的温度场、坯壳厚度及液芯长度等,便于现场调整工艺参数.
【Abstract】 A three dimensional model of fluid flowing and solidification within the beam blank was established. The influence of fluid on solidification was carefully surveyed. This model can not only analyze the relation between shell and steel fluid, but also compare the temperature distribution in the different technical conditions which can be used to forecast the temperature field, solidification profile and liquid pool depth and adjust technical parameters.
